Global Cloud TV Market to Reach US$6.0 Billion by 2030
The global market for Cloud TV estimated at US$1.5 Billion in the year 2024, is expected to reach US$6.0 Billion by 2030, growing at a CAGR of 25.9% over the analysis period 2024-2030. Public Cloud Deployment, one of the segments analyzed in the report, is expected to record a 29.3% CAGR and reach US$3.5 Billion by the end of the analysis period. Growth in the Private Cloud Deployment segment is estimated at 23.3% CAGR over the analysis period.
The U.S. Market is Estimated at US$408.4 Million While China is Forecast to Grow at 34.7% CAGR
The Cloud TV market in the U.S. is estimated at US$408.4 Million in the year 2024. China, the world's second largest economy, is forecast to reach a projected market size of US$1.5 Billion by the year 2030 trailing a CAGR of 34.7% over the analysis period 2024-2030. Among the other noteworthy geographic markets are Japan and Canada, each forecast to grow at a CAGR of 20.5% and 23.5% respectively over the analysis period. Within Europe, Germany is forecast to grow at approximately 21.9% CAGR.
Global Cloud TV Market - Key Trends & Drivers Summarized
What is Fueling the Evolution of Cloud TV?
Cloud TV has emerged as a transformative force in the entertainment industry, redefining how content is streamed, distributed, and consumed. Unlike traditional cable or satellite television, Cloud TV enables on-demand access to a vast array of multimedia content over the internet, eliminating the need for set-top boxes or bulky hardware. The increasing proliferation of smart devices, combined with high-speed internet penetration, has significantly contributed to the widespread adoption of this technology. The convenience and affordability of Cloud TV services have further driven consumer preference towards this model, especially among younger demographics who prioritize flexibility over conventional broadcasting constraints. Moreover, content providers are leveraging cloud technology to enhance scalability, ensuring seamless streaming experiences even during peak demand hours.
How is Technological Innovation Reshaping the Cloud TV Landscape?
One of the key drivers of Cloud TV’s growth is the integration of advanced technologies such as artificial intelligence (AI), machine learning (ML), and edge computing. AI-driven algorithms personalize content recommendations, improving user engagement and retention rates. Additionally, cloud-based AI solutions assist in content moderation, enhancing compliance with regional regulations and licensing agreements. Meanwhile, the adoption of 5G networks is set to revolutionize Cloud TV by significantly reducing buffering times and improving streaming quality across various devices. The emergence of Virtual Reality (VR) and Augmented Reality (AR) in the entertainment sector is also expected to further enhance immersive viewing experiences, making Cloud TV a highly dynamic ecosystem. Furthermore, partnerships between Cloud TV providers and telecom operators have allowed for bundling strategies that improve accessibility and affordability for consumers worldwide.
Why Are Media Companies Rapidly Transitioning to Cloud TV?
The economic advantages of Cloud TV have spurred widespread adoption among media companies, broadcasters, and content creators. Cost-efficiency plays a significant role, as cloud-based streaming eliminates the need for extensive physical infrastructure and reduces operational expenditures. Traditional content distribution models require substantial investment in broadcasting infrastructure, whereas Cloud TV allows companies to scale up or down effortlessly based on demand. In addition, advertising revenue models have been increasingly optimized through data-driven insights, enabling targeted advertisements that maximize monetization opportunities. Subscription-based Video-on-Demand (SVoD) and Advertising-based Video-on-Demand (AVoD) platforms have witnessed exponential growth, with major players such as Netflix, Amazon Prime Video, and Disney+ continuously expanding their cloud capabilities to cater to diverse consumer preferences. The shift towards multi-platform content delivery, spanning smart TVs, mobile devices, and web browsers, further amplifies the potential of Cloud TV services.
